ALL meanings of ahimsa
a·him·sa
A a - noun ahimsa (in Hindu, Buddhist, and Jainist philosophy) the law of reverence for, and nonviolence to, every form of life 3
- noun ahimsa the doctrine that all life is one and sacred, resulting in the principle of nonviolence toward all living creatures 3
- noun ahimsa the principle of noninjury to living beings. 1
- noun ahimsa (in the Hindu, Buddhist, and Jain tradition) the principle of nonviolence toward all living things. 1
